Quote from willygee :
... calculate cost of protein per serving grams? ...
Just looking at the supplement facts:
Protein per serving: 30 grams
Servings per container: 45

30*45/$30.49 = 44.27 grams per dollar. Plus there's $2.70 worth of creatine in it and whatever you value BCAAs at
